Problems passing emissions, need advice.
Hey!
I just took emissions and I failed. Everything checked out fine except for HC which was 2 points above the limit. I'm guessing I'm running a little rich. I just changed my oil, new filter, air filter, do you think this should take care of it?
If not, do you have any other suggestions?
Thanks!

that's the problem big boy, you didn't say what year.
check the timing, crack open the intake manifold and see if there's tar like sustain inside.
honda sells a "engine top cleaner" which could really help you out.
and make sure there's no CEL in the last 50 miles, even with a reset, the long term fuel trim needs around 50 miles to be adjusted

ok well I passed it just fine today. I ran almost half a can into the intake manifold through the pcv valve tube, to clean the top part of the valves, changed the o2 and
took the filter and passed the emmisions without a problem.
